Is 141 855 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 141 855 is about 376.636.

Thus, the square root of 141 855 is not an integer, and therefore 141 855 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 141 855?

The square of a number (here 141 855) is the result of the product of this number (141 855) by itself (i.e., 141 855 × 141 855); the square of 141 855 is sometimes called "raising 141 855 to the power 2", or "141 855 squared".

The square of 141 855 is 20 122 841 025 because 141 855 × 141 855 = 141 8552 = 20 122 841 025.

As a consequence, 141 855 is the square root of 20 122 841 025.
